Transaction 21ebf263c72c9c481392a5535b07aacd1217fb4b8a5b798cb3f3dcd421182cfe
1 Input
2 Outputs
- 21ebf263c72c9c481392a5535b07aacd1217fb4b8a5b798cb3f3dcd421182cfe:0
- 21ebf263c72c9c481392a5535b07aacd1217fb4b8a5b798cb3f3dcd421182cfe:1
value 49685285
address 1CrBt1h9CZHrXQWukcD5dyaSXpEV1zx8PZ
value 3684216899
address 16q9Hg6DSW7f2LdAC7GfhCVHMJTHPDnLxa